3.3.4 Identification of UV Absorption Spectra of MDEA

Direct photolysis of an organic compound by UV light usually occurs when the organic compound absorb UV light. Identification of the UV spectrum region absorbed by MDEA was conducted using UV-VIS-NIR spectrophotometer SHIMADZU UV-3150, Japan. MDEA solution was prepared and tested at = 200 to 600 nm regions.

3.3.5 Un-reacted MDEA and Degradation Product Identification using HPLC

An Agilent series 1100 brand of HPLC was used to monitor the degradation products and un-reacted MDEA after UVH 2 O 2 treatment. YMC-Pack PolymerC18 reverse phase column was utilized. A solution consisting of 60 Na 2 HPO 4 100mM and 40 NaOH 100mM at pH = 12 was used for elution. 69 UV light at 215 nm was used as detector. Transgenomic Model ORH801 column was used for organic acid determination with 0.01 N H 2 SO 4 as mobile phase. Refractive index was used as detector. Degradation product determination was performed by the comparison of sample with the standard compound. Qualitative analysis was based on the retention time of each compound in the chromatogram, while quantitative analysis was based on the calibration curve prepared using standard compound. The details of the calibration curves for different compounds tested are presented in Table 3.3 and the plots of concentration vs. area are presented in Figure 1, 2, 3, and 4 of Appendix.
